Regis Women’s Soccer Unable to Complete Rally at SJC

STANDISH, Maine - Regis College could not complete a comeback from a two-goal deficit, as Saint Joseph's College held on for a 2-1 victory Saturday afternoon in a Great Northeast Athletic Conference (GNAC) women's collegiate soccer match at the SJC Athletics Complex.

The Monks struck first in the 18th minute as a crossing pass by Madison Michaud squirted through the arms of Regis goalie Daniela Mazo (Bridgeport, Conn.), with Aaliyah Wilson-Falcone chipping the loose ball into the net. Mazo did make three saves in the first half to keep the margin at one goal, while the Pride's best scoring opportunity came in the final seconds of the half when Retta Hatin's (Hooksett, N.H.) long shot hit the crossbar.

Michaud nearly extended the Monk lead four minutes into the second half, but the Pride defense kept the ball from crossing the goal line for a team save. Meanwhile, Hatin and Payton Bridge (Norton, Mass.) threatened to tie the match, but Monk keeper Carly Downey was able to make the save on both shot attempts.

Saint Joseph's College (8-8-1, 8-3-1 GNAC) picked up its insurance goal in the 67th minute when Samantha Colatruglio set up Michaud for her 10th goal of the season. The Monks kept the pressure on the Pride defense, as Lelia Weir took a shot that hit the left post while Michaud's scoring attempt was turned away by Mazo.

In the 82nd minute, after a foul by Saint Joseph's College, Tia Zanardi (Haverhill, Mass.) launched a free kick into the box, and Aria Ulmer (Henniker, N.H.) directed the ball into the net on a header for her fourth goal of the season. The Pride created one final scoring opportunity in the 89th minute, but Downey was able to corral a shot by Meadow Comeiro (Woburn, Mass.), and the Monks held possession as the clock ran out.

For the second straight match, Mazo finished with six saves, while Downey ended up with five saves for the Monks. Saint Joseph's College outshot Regis, 23-11, led by Michaud and Wilson-Falcone with four shots apiece.

Regis College (9-5-2, 8-3-1 GNAC) closes out the regular season against Dean College Wednesday, Oct. 26, starting at 7:30 p.m. in the Purple the Pitch match, as the team will be raising money for the Alzheimer's Association.
